Navigating Your Professional Journey: Tips for Job Advancement

Embarking on a professional journey is an exciting and challenging endeavor. As you progress in your career, it's essential to have a clear roadmap for job advancement. Whether you're looking to climb the corporate ladder, switch industries, or start your own business, here are some valuable tips to help you navigate your path to success.

1. Set Clear Goals

Define your short-term and long-term career goals. Having a clear vision of where you want to be will guide your decisions and actions along the way. Break down your goals into actionable steps and regularly review and adjust them as needed.

2. Continuous Learning

Stay current in your field by pursuing continuous learning opportunities. This can include attending workshops, taking online courses, obtaining certifications, or pursuing advanced degrees. Embrace lifelong learning to stay competitive in today's ever-evolving job market.

3. Seek Mentorship

Find a mentor who can provide guidance, support, and valuable insights based on their own professional experiences. A mentor can help you navigate challenges, expand your network, and accelerate your career growth.

4. Network Effectively

Build and nurture professional relationships within and outside your industry. Attend networking events, join professional organizations, and utilize social media platforms like LinkedIn to connect with like-minded professionals. Networking can open doors to new opportunities and help you stay informed about industry trends.

5. Showcase Your Skills

Highlight your skills, accomplishments, and contributions in your current role. Take on challenging projects, seek feedback, and demonstrate your value to your employer. Updating your resume and LinkedIn profile regularly with your achievements can also help you stand out to potential employers.

6. Embrace Challenges

Be open to taking on new challenges and stepping out of your comfort zone. Embracing challenges can help you grow professionally, develop new skills, and demonstrate your adaptability and resilience to employers.

7. Stay Resilient

Job advancement may not always happen as quickly as you'd like, and setbacks are a natural part of any career journey. Stay resilient in the face of challenges, learn from failures, and maintain a positive attitude. Persistence and determination are key to achieving your career goals.

Professional Journey

By incorporating these tips into your professional journey, you can navigate the path to job advancement with confidence and purpose. Remember that success is a journey, not a destination, and each step you take brings you closer to your career goals.
